Bee.

That's how he'd say it, passing me in the corridor. Never explaining.

I was in my early twenties, in a job nobody had trained me for. So I improvised. I sorted by order, by colour, built the whole system, watched it run for a few weeks, and saw what didn't work. I took it apart. I started again.

It took me a while to ask. Why the bee?

When she isn't flying, she's making wax.

I never knew whether it was a compliment. Maybe he thought I was slow. Maybe he'd seen something I couldn't see yet.

I kept the name anyway. And years later I added my own part: a bee doesn't make her honey in a single field. She goes out, searches far, takes a little from everywhere, and only transforms it afterwards.

Twenty years on and I'm the same. I build, I look, I change.

Except now what passes through my hands is people.

Manifesto

I do not believe that two bodies can be treated in the same way.

Each person arrives with their own rhythm, fatigue and tension, and often with things they do not yet have the words for. That is why I have never followed a protocol.

I listen before I touch. I observe before I decide. And I let the session follow what this body asks for, on this day.

Techniques matter. They never come before the person.

I do not try to repeat gestures. Even someone who returns for the same session will not receive the same thing, because they do not arrive in the same state. Nothing here is automatic. That may be my only rule.

The length of the session is set in advance, and it is planned generously. Not so that I can watch the clock, but so that I never have to rush.

I believe the body only lets go when it feels safe. And that safety takes time. Time to listen. Time to understand. Time to care.

This is the way of working I have chosen to build, and that I will continue to build well beyond the room where I receive people today.
